Trade Deficit Upside Surprise By $18bn

The US goods trade deficit surged by $18 billion, significantly exceeding consensus estimates as imports continue to rise.

Source: DepositPhotos

Goods trade deficit larger than before the election. So much for tariffs reducing goods imports relative to pre tariff.

Figure 1: Goods trade balance, BoP basis (black), Census basis (red), Bloomberg consensus (blue +), all in mn.$ s.a. Source: BEA via FRED, Census, and author’s calculations.


Goods imports are rising.

Figure 2: Goods imports (black),  BoP basis through April, Census basis thereafter, all in mn.$ s.a. Source: BEA via FRED, Census, and author’s calculations.


Census basis is about 2bn more than BoP basis, in May and June, so a small difference.
